Cotton Incorporated Working on Nitrogen Inputs

Randall Weiseman Alabama, Cotton, Georgia

Nitrogen is an input that touches cotton farmers on multiple levels and vice president of Agricultural Research for Cotton Incorporated, Kater Hake, says they are involved in a 10-year research effort to steadily improve nitrogen applications. AL Ag Commissioner Warns of Potential Crop Crisis

Randall Weiseman Alabama, Corn, Cotton, Field Crops, Peanuts, Soybeans

MONTGOMERY– Commissioner Ron Sparks warns that Alabama agricultural producers are in a potential crisis mode concerning the fall 2009 crop harvest, according to a recent assessment conducted across the state. Implementation of Farm Bill’s Horticulture and Organic Ag Provisions Examined

Randall Weiseman Alabama, Florida, Georgia, Specialty Crops, Vegetables

A House Ag Subcommittee hearing this week focused on the implementation of provisions regarding specialty crops, organic agriculture and plant pest and disease management that were placed in the 2008 Farm Bill. NCBA Continues to Call for Death Tax Reform

Randall Weiseman Alabama, Cattle, Florida, General, Georgia, Livestock

The National Cattlemen’s Beef Association continues to urge Congress to pass legislation providing additional relief and permanency in the tax code for America’s farmers and ranchers as Colin Woodall, NCBA Executive Director of Legislative Affairs, said they will continue to fight this issue for producers across the country.
